Outline of Final Research Achievements |
First, we tested the utility of T-TAS in patients with coronary artery disease (CAD) with or without antiplatelet therapies. We measured PL-AUC levels by T-TAS in 372 patients who were divided into three groups; patients not on any antiplatelet therapy (control), on aspirin only, and on aspirin and clopidogrel. PL-AUC levels were significantly lower in two antiplatelet therapy groups compared with control group, and the level was significantly lower in the aspirin/clopidogrel group than aspirin group. Next, we evaluated the utility of T-TAS in predicting periprocedural bleeding in patients with atrial fibrillation (AF) undergoing catheter ablation (CA) by measuring AR-AUC levels on the day, 3 and 30 days post-CA. AR-AUC levels at the day of CA and 3 days post-CA was associated with periprocedural bleeding events, suggesting that AR-AUC level determined by T-TAS is a potentially useful marker for prediction of bleeding events in AF patients undergoing CA.
